How Do Smart Timer Connectivity Options Affect Battery Life?

Bluetooth or Wi-Fi connectivity significantly increases power consumption, reducing battery life by 20-50% compared to non-connected digital timers.

The addition of Bluetooth or Wi-Fi to a kitchen timer, while offering advanced control via smartphone apps, comes at a cost. Wireless communication modules require continuous power, even in standby, which can drastically shorten battery life. A basic digital timer might run for 12-18 months on a single set of AAA batteries, whereas a connected smart timer could require new batteries every 4-8 months, depending on usage frequency and connection strength.

When assessing the true cost of ownership, it’s essential to factor in these more frequent battery replacements. Over five years, a connected timer could demand $25-$50 in batteries alone, a hidden cost that few consider upfront. How Do Water Resistance Ratings Impact Timer Longevity in a Kitchen?

An IPX4 or higher water resistance rating protects against splashes, significantly extending a timer’s life in a busy kitchen environment.

Splashes and moisture are inevitable in any kitchen. A timer with a basic level of water resistance, typically indicated by an IPX4 rating, can withstand splashes from the sink or stovetop without immediate damage. While you shouldn’t submerge it, this protection is vital for longevity. Absence of any water resistance rating suggests a timer that could fail quickly from typical kitchen accidents.

How Do Battery Costs Factor into the Long-Term Value?

Battery replacements add $5-10 annually to a timer’s cost. Rechargeable batteries, while more expensive initially, can save 60-80% over 3-5 years.

For a timer requiring 2 AAA batteries every 6-12 months, the annual cost can be $5-$10 or more, depending on battery brand and purchase volume. Over a five-year period, this can easily add $25-$50 to the total cost. Switching to rechargeable AAA batteries, with an initial investment of $20-$30 for a charger and four batteries, can reduce this recurring expense significantly. The lower environmental impact of rechargeable batteries is another compelling reason to consider them.

Can Smart Timer Accessories Drive Up the Overall Running Cost?

Some smart timers rely on subscriptions for advanced features or proprietary batteries, which can significantly inflate the running cost over time.

While less common in the ‘affordable’ category, some advanced smart timers may come with hidden costs like premium app subscriptions for data logging or advanced cooking profiles. Additionally, timers that use proprietary battery packs rather than standard AA/AAA cells can lead to higher replacement costs and potential obsolescence if those specific batteries become unavailable. Always check for these potential pitfalls before committing to a purchase.
